Hello All,

Can some one please tell me how long it takes to make a police report and get it in mail.

First one is the Police Passport Report? How long? Can it be picked up or its just mailed?

Second, Local Police report? How long? Can it be picked up or mailed ONLY?

Also, what documents do they ask for in order to get a police report. Please help us.

Please help

PPC can be obtained from the regional passport office and that may take just one day.

PC from the local police can be obtained from the local SP office or district police office and that might take a while depending upon what part of the country you are in.

You can show a copy of NOA2.

Hello,

Passport office does not take long.

The local police departments can drag their feet. Have to be on them. Also if you are going throught the K3 visa process, make sure you get them to make 2 ceritified copies of the report. That way if your CR1/IR1 comes through on or soon after the K3 you are ready. Both the NVC for CR1 and the US Embassy K-3 expect one. It just gives you more options, because I am hearing that if your CR1 paperwork is on the way to the embassy at the time of your K3 visa, they might give you the CR1 interview in place of your K3.

I am learning all this at the last minute. Police report is now on the way to the NVC and K3 interview is in approximately one month and we only had on cert. police report.

I dont know where your beneficiary lives but in my case it's south bombay and the passport police certificate took 45 days... its ridiculous how the process takes so long.

Passport Police Cert Process in Mumbai: Passport Office --> CID (Commissioner office) --> Local Police Station --> CID Office --> Passport Office (they issue you a little document). Most time in our case took at local police station... it was ridiculous.
